What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Windchill Support position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Windchill Support professional, you need a solid understanding of Product Lifecycle Management (PLM) concepts, experience with PTC Windchill software, and a background in IT, engineering, or computer science. Familiarity with database management, scripting languages, and Windchill certifications such as PTC Certified Professional are often highly valued. Strong problem-solving skills, effective communication, and a collaborative attitude are important soft skills in this role. These competencies are essential for resolving technical issues efficiently, ensuring smooth user experiences, and supporting cross-functional engineering and product teams.

What is a Windchill Support job?

A Windchill Support job involves providing technical assistance, troubleshooting, and maintenance for PTC Windchill, a product lifecycle management (PLM) software. Responsibilities include resolving user issues, managing system configurations, and ensuring smooth operation of Windchill environments. Support specialists may also assist with upgrades, integrations, and performance optimizations. Strong problem-solving skills and knowledge of PLM processes are essential for this role.

As part of the engineering IT support team, the Windchill/PTC IT Support Specialist will provide dedicated technical support for Windchill PLM and other PTC products across the organization.

Role Responsibilities:

  • Provides tier 2/3 technical support for Windchill PLM, Creo, and other PTC applications
  • Administers, maintains, and troubleshoots Windchill servers and infrastructure
  • Manages user accounts, permissions, roles, and access controls within Windchill
  • Configures and customizes Windchill workflows, lifecycles, and business rules
  • Assists with Windchill upgrades, patches, and system enhancements
  • Develops and maintains integration between Windchill and other enterprise systems (ERP, CAD, etc.)
  • Creates and maintains documentation for system configurations, procedures, and user guides
  • Trains end-users on Windchill functionality and best practices
  • Monitors system performance and implements optimization strategies
  • Collaborates with engineering teams to understand requirements and implement solutions
  • Manages data migration, import/export activities, and bulk operations
  • Provides backup and disaster recovery support for Windchill environments
